参数化执行sql,如何返回完整的sql? - .NET技术 / C#
数据库的操作都是使用的参数化来执行,现在需要记录日志,则需要记录下来完整执行的sql语句。这样参数化的就得不到完整的sql语句都是参数,没有值,我采用自己拼接的方式,但是工程量太大了,我个人觉得即使是参数化的执行方式,到底来说还是执行的sql,ado中应该可以获取的,请指教?
自己顶上来。
参数化的sql语句比较好,你的日志可以把sql语句+参数的值一起保存下来呀
http://topic.csdn.net/u/20091128/11/7d4ccb82-5f6f-4615-b226-a1678c597d32.html
怎么这么深奥啊,从来没有用过日志文件,这有什么用啊
打开sql profiler,选中“保存到文件”选项。然后自己分析。这个工具还有其他丰富的选项,这个连接我觉得说的已经比较清楚了(英文):
配置sql profiler
另外还可看联机丛书等
(⊙o⊙)… 有意思 关注
带参数的sql执行不是直接发你想要的sql语句,估计只能自己取参数值拼接。
否则在SQL Server的服务器端编程了。
关注
关注
顶一个
相关问答:
执行的顺序:
1)文件浏览框(选择文件使用)
选择好文件后
点击一个导入按钮的时候 ,把上面上传框里的csv文件以一个ID为文件名,上传到**/**文件夹下
2)读取这个文件夹下的csv的文件,转换成sql
3 ......
现在有两张表:文章主表A(articleId,articleTitle),文章评论表B(commentId,articleId,commentTitle)
现在我想实现这样的功能:列出文章列表,其中每篇文章标题下面列出此文章的前2个文章评论,请问sql语句怎么写啊 ......
sql的软件在哪里可以下啊!在网上找了蛮多都用不了啊
随便搞一D版吧,
迅雷第一个就可以用
2000,2005都这样
http://119.147.41.16/down?cid=0698C2D64D7D637D90A6D2482298E6717D4F15CD&t=2&fmt=-1 ......
表数据
COL1 COL2 COL2 COL4 COL5
----------------------------------------------------------------------------------------------
2010-05-05 00:00 ......